How Nicotine Level Batches Are Checked
The cheapest quality control step is a retained sample. Keeping three sealed units from every nicotine level batch costs almost nothing and turns any dispute into a simple comparison instead of an argument over photographs.
AQL sampling gets a lot of attention, but for nicotine level the more useful habit is simply measuring the same three things on every single batch. Trend lines catch problems that pass/fail checks miss.

Logistics That Protect Margin
Model nicotine level freight both ways before choosing a method: cost per unit and cost per week of delay. The second figure is the one that decides whether a cheap option was actually cheap.

Frequently Asked Questions
Can I visit the production facility?
Yes, and we encourage it for larger programmes. Visits are most useful when you already have a draft specification, because you can then check the specific processes behind the numbers you care about.
Can the packaging be customised?
Yes. Most nicotine level programmes use private label packaging once volumes justify the printing plate. We supply dielines, check your artwork for print issues and hold approved files so reorders need no new setup.
How do you handle a short shipment?
Cartons are counted and weighed before dispatch and the figures are shared with you. If something is short on arrival, the packing record and the carrier documentation are both available, which keeps the claim straightforward.
What if a batch does not match the sample?
Keep the retained samples from the approval stage. If a delivered batch measurably differs, we compare against the retained set and resolve it against the production record. This is why we insist on sealed retained units from every run.
